
We Can't Even March Straight by Edmund Hall
Within NATO only Britain and the USA discriminate against homosexuals in the armed forces, and there are indications that more than 260 homosexuals have been forced to leave Britain's forces since 1990. Drawing on many first-hand experiences, this book is a personal testimony and a plea for change. The author served as a naval officer for two years before acknowledging his homosexuality and resigning his commission.| SKU | Unavailable |
